WHEN you are riding one of the leading fancies for a Cheltenham Gold Cup, the pressure is enormous.

- BY ANDY DUNN

Big day holds no fears for rising star

KING BEN Ben Jones celebrates The Jukebox Man's victory in the King George VI Chase at Kempton

When you are riding a leading fancy for a Cheltenham Gold Cup that just happens to be owned by a national treasure, that pressure is cranked up a gear.

But that will not bother one of National Hunt's rising stars. In terms of wins, Ben Jones is already assured of his best season.

And, of course, the 26-year-old Welshman has big victories to his name, winning the 2024 Festival Plate on Shakem Up'Arry.
